The Science Behind Solar Panels:
1. **No Sun, No Power:**
Solar panels need sunlight to create an electric current. When the sun sets, there’s no sunlight, and thus, the panels don’t produce electricity.
2. **Storage Solutions:**
Some solar setups include energy storage solutions like batteries. These batteries store excess energy generated during the day, allowing you to use solar power at night.
3. **Grid Connection:**
If your home is connected to the electrical grid, you can still have power at night. When your solar panels produce more energy than you need during the day, the excess can be fed back into the grid. In return, you can draw power from the grid at night.
